First load the configuration.
For Pharo:
Gofer new
squeaksource: 'MetacelloRepository';
package: 'ConfigurationOfSeaside';
load.
For Squeak:
- load the latest version of ConfigurationOfSeaside from
http://www.squeaksource.com/MetacelloRepository
Then pick the Seaside variant you want to load:
"Seaside 2.8"
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Seaside 2.8'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Seaside 2.8 Examples'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Magritte'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Magritte Tests'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Pier'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Pier Tests'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Pier AddOns'.
"Seaside 3.0"
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Seaside 3.0'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Seaside 3.0 Tests'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Magritte2'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Magritte2 Tests'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Pier2'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Pier2 Tests'.
ConfigurationOfSeaside project latestVersion load: 'Pier2 AddOns'.
I've tested the various loads with PharoCore-1.0-10508rc2 and Squeak3.11-8931-alpha.
The tests aren't 100% green on either platform...
